Understanding the Tretinoin Course: A Guide to Your Skincare Journey

Tretinoin, a derivative of vitamin A, is a powerful topical treatment widely used in dermatology for various skin conditions. Its benefits range from treating acne to reducing the appearance of fine lines and hyperpigmentation. However, using tretinoin effectively requires understanding its course and how to integrate it into your skincare routine.

What is Tretinoin?

Tretinoin is a prescription medication commonly prescribed by dermatologists for treating severe acne and photoaging. It is known for its ability to speed up cell turnover, promoting exfoliation of the skin, thereby preventing clogged pores and reducing the appearance of wrinkles and dark spots.

How to Start a Tretinoin Course

  1. Consult a Dermatologist: Always start with a professional evaluation to determine if tretinoin is suitable for your skin type.
  2. Understand the Concentration: Tretinoin comes in various strengths. Your dermatologist will prescribe the appropriate concentration based on your skin needs.
  3. Begin Slowly: Start with applying tretinoin every third night to allow your skin to acclimate to the medication.
  4. Hydrate and Moisturize: Incorporate a gentle, hydrating moisturizer to minimize dryness and irritation.
  5. Be Consistent: Consistency is key. Gradually increase frequency as your skin adjusts, following your dermatologist’s recommendations.
  6. Sun Protection: Always apply sunscreen during the day, as tretinoin increases photosensitivity.

Side Effects of Tretinoin

While tretinoin is effective, it can also cause side effects, especially during the initial adjustment period. Common side effects include:

  • Dryness and peeling
  • Redness and irritation
  • Burning or stinging sensation
  • Increased sensitivity to sunlight

It is crucial to monitor any severe reactions and consult your dermatologist if you experience significant discomfort.
